Yesterday the Euro and the stock markets tumbled as Europe's debt crises deepened. More than £13 billion was wiped off the value of London's biggest shares, this is because of fears that Portugal like Greece is going to need a second bailout.
It is feared by analysts that it might not stop there and might spread back to Ireland and to Spain and Italy. Currently Greece's borrowing costs are running at 15.9 per cent, Portugal's have reached 12.6 per cent, Ireland's 12.4 per cent and Italy's bond yields hit a three year high above 5 per cent. This is basically what it costs for these countries to borrow any money, the only people who will buy Greek bonds are the European Central Bank, and the Chinese have said they will help. You can only imagine what this means for Greece and the rest of Europe.
If you compare the borrowing costs for the UK 3.2 per cent, the US 3.1 per cent and Germany 2.9 per cent it really puts things into perspective. To put it simply the Euro in its present form is unsaveable.
Portugal is likely to need a second bailout to its original bailout of £70 billion, and Greece is likely to need even more than the initial £98.5 billion agreed last year.
